How do I transfer money from one bank to another internationally?
Option 1: Make an international bank transfer online
- Find the wire transfer section on your bank’s website.
- Double-check your online transfer limit.
- Enter the recipient’s bank details.
- Enter the amount and choose the currency you want for the recipient bank.
- Pay the transfer processing fee.

How long does it take to send money by telegraph?
Send money: Once you have sent money via telegraphic transfer, it will take 2-4 days for the funds to reflect in the beneficiary account. These are the basic steps involved in a telegraphic transfer, but your bank may request more information about your money transfer to meet internal security policies or anti-laundering regulations.
How long does it take to do a telegraphic transfer?
Generally, a telegraphic transfer takes 2- 4 days to complete depending on various factors including the origin and destination of the transfer, the currencies involved, and the amount being transferred. Also, since the transfer occurs across international borders, the process can take longer due to different time zones, weekends, and holidays.
